Sector Rotation Strategies Leveraging S&P 500 Sector ETFs for Returns
Navigating the dynamic landscape of the stock market often involves a strategic approach. One such strategy is sector rotation, which entails shifting investments among various sectors of the economy based on their trends. By utilizing S&P 500 sector ETFs, investors can efficiently implement this strategic approach and potentially enhance returns.
- Furthermore, sector rotation allows investors to exploit the cyclical nature of different industries.
- For example, during periods of economic expansion, sectors such as consumer discretionary and industrials may surpass others. Conversely, in a slowing environment, defensive sectors like healthcare and utilities might demonstrate stability.
- As a result, by shifting investments between these sectors, investors can potentially mitigate risk and enhance portfolio returns over the long term.
Dabbling in S&P 500 Sector ETFs: Understanding the Risks and Rewards
Diving into the world of exchange-traded funds (ETFs) tied to specific sectors within the S&P 500 can present both alluring opportunities and inherent dangers. These investment vehicles offer a streamlined method to concentrate particular industry segments, potentially amplifying returns if that sector executes. Conversely, sector-specific ETFs are inherently unstable, meaning their values can fluctuate significantly based on the outcomes of that individual sector. Prior to venturing into this realm, individuals should thoroughly evaluate their risk tolerance and investment aims.
